π Carousel Horse EmojiUnicode: 1F3A0
A wooden horse from a merry-go-round, often seen at fairs and amusement parks. Used to evoke nostalgia, childhood memories, and whimsy.
Released in Released in 2010 with Unicode 6.0

Meaning and Interpretation
π The carousel horse emoji is all about nostalgia and good times at the fair or amusement park. It's a wooden horse from a merry-go-round, so itβs often used to share throwback photos of carnival trips or to express a whimsical, childlike feeling. On Instagram, you'll see it in captions for fair and festival photos, and on TikTok it pops up in videos about nostalgic summer memories or amusement park fun.
